I hope you have gotten help since posting this, since it was nearly a month ago. If not, here is some help from my limited knowledge.

 

For leveling, I would suggest purchasing a Moon Hunter and going to Oasis or Cursed Land and killing mini monsters at night. They give large amounts of experience, especially at your level. You can do that until about 120. If you get bored of it, you can begin to get Daily Quests for FT1 and FT2 at level 110 and 115 which give you a large sum of experience.

 

In terms of your skills, this is my current skill layout.

 

Mental Mastery - 10

Watornado - 10

Enchant Weapon - 10

 

Energy Shield - between 5-10

Spirit Elemental - 10

 

Fire Elemental - 10 (for tanking)

Flame Wave - 10 (Combined with Watornado for most DPS)

Distortion - the rest

 

Magic Source - 10

Stone Spike - 10 (Main AoE damage)

 

~Use Dia or Meteorite until you can get lvl 10 Stone Spike

~Enchant Weapon boosts your attack damage, so it is extremely important

~Energy Shield drains a lot of mana so you can decide how high you want to level it

~Watornado is different than original skill. It is a 12 second duration damage amplifier. Use it and then Flame Wave for max damage.

 

Hopefully this helps!

szreed98
On 2/3/2020 at 10:55 PM, donmiguel said:

hi how about the statistics? how much str agi and health should i put?

Str, tal, agi = as much needed for equipment

Everything into int, unless you're finding it hard to survive then start pumping into health. Right now I have 260 int and 100 health, with points as needed into the others for equipment.
